What is the most sold Volkswagen part?
The sausage is humorously branded as a Volkswagen Originalteil Volkswagen Original Part under part number 199 398 500 A. The product has been described as the most-produced of any of Volkswagen’s parts, with some 7 million sausages made in 2019. In many recent years, the company has produced more sausages than cars. In fact, it doesn’t even have wheels. VW’s best-seller is original part number 199 398 500 A: its currywurst sausage. And until recently, the company sold more of these sausages than it did cars on a yearly basis.
